Momo not getting benefit of the doubt

Last updated : 24 October 2006 By Al Campbell
The Liverpool midfielder picked up his fourth booking of the season during Sunday's defeat at Old Trafford. However, Rafa Benitez believes the Mali international is not getting the same leeway referees are giving to other players.

"There is also a problem with how Momo Sissoko is treated. He was booked very early again by the same referee who booked him very early against Everton," said Benitez.

"It is easier, it seems, to show a yellow card to Momo rather than Rio Ferdinand or Steven Gerrard. I am very disappointed with this situation, and I realise that when it happens he cannot challenge in the same way because he has one card.

"But I do not want to use excuses, I would rather find solutions from our own players."
